谁能帮我写两个批处理文件,用来修改ip地址和dns的

来源:百度知道 编辑:UC知道 时间:2024/06/24 14:16:53
如题,IP地址和DNS分别为

IP地址:192.168.1.82
子网掩码:255.255.255.0
网关:192.168.1.1
DNS:221.7.128.68

另一个:
IP地址:10.0.0.82
子网掩码:255.255.255.0
网关:10.0.0.1

第二个不需要DNS

谢谢
solone1020,你的答案不错,但第二个方案运行之后,原第一个方案的DNS还在,我需要的是空白,能改一下吗?

@echo off
netsh interface IP Set Address "本地连接" Static "192.168.1.82" "255.255.255.0" "192.168.1.1" 1
netsh interface ip set dns name="本地连接" source=static addr="221.7.128.68"

@echo off
netsh interface IP Set Address "本地连接" Static "10.0.0.82
" "255.255.255.0" "10.0.0.1" 1
netsh interface ip set dns name="本地连接" DHCP

如果你的网卡名不为本地接连,改成本地连接

好了。差不多了。

http://www.javaeye.com/topic/266383 参考这个

珊珊来迟了。。。

第一个有DNS的:
@echo off
set slection1=
set/p slection1=请输入IP地址:
netsh interface ip set address name="本地连接" source=static addr=%slection1% mask=255.255.255.0
set slection2=
set/p slection2=请输入网关地址:
netsh interface ip set address name="本地连接" gateway=%slection2% gwmetric=0